Hello and Happy Friday! If you've been following me for any amount of time, you will know that I'm smitten by the Hero Arts Infinity Dies. They are so versatile, today I will be using them in a scenery card.

I started with the new Nesting House, I cut it a couple times, for the house base, the roof and the chimney. The door is a trimmed down Rectangle Infinity Die.

The door window is the smallest Nesting Heart Infinity Die. I flanked the door with Fir Trees.

The Nesting Cloudy Infinity Dies have been cut from Craft Foam for a bit more dimension in my design. Everything is nestled on a Nesting Circle Infinity Die.

 

The sentiment is from the House Stamp & Cut. The base is the Wallpaper Pattern Bold Prints stamped on Earth Mix Layering Paper. I've also used Pool, Foliage and Blush Mix Layering Papers in my design.
